WD MyBook WorldEdition

Strengths: Productised network storage

Weakness: Ties you into MioNet

DO NOT BUY this product unless you want to be tied into proprietary software to access your data. This product may suit domestic users, with limited networking, but is NOT a useful Network Storage System for a multiple machine network. I'd recommend the Buffalo.

Cool WD MyBook WorldEdition

Strengths: Share file out of the box after attach to the network. It is a useful network storage device if you have linux experience to install another software.

Weakness: none.

After I got my WD MyBook WE, I hack it to disable Mionet and install many software such as php server, torrent, ... The result it work well. I can use torrent with no need turn on my PC. I can do my web server, file server, share file in windows or linux, printer server, and much more because you can download free linux source codes, compile and use it in this toy.

WD Networked HDD Sucks

Strengths: Storage size

Weakness: Connectivity, accessibility

The drive goes offline on it's own whenever, and sometimes the only way to get it back online is to unplug it and plug it back in. When it is online, sometimes I have issues trying to access files. Sometimes it locks my computer out of files I had no problem accessing the day before.

good price but slow interface

Strengths: Has Ethernet connection and usb connection for a cheep price it is a good server

Weakness: slow interface and write speeds. Programs are very poor in design.

This NAS is a good price but it has a slow interface so you cant take advantage of the 1GB connection. The programs that come along with the HD are very bad in quality. I downloaded my own backup program for free. I couldn't get the dynamic addressing to work so you have to set up a static address.
